STEM at Sea is a hands-on learning cruise for curious kids and their grown-ups, blending science, engineering, history, art, music, practical skills and interactive activities with the magic of family travel. Families will explore, play and learn together through themed classes, beach meetups, bedtime stories, a group book exchange and real-world adventures at sea and in port.
The program began with the idea of You and Me at Sea and STEAM at Sea, focused on early childhood learning, caregiver connection and screen-free family enrichment. It has now grown into STEM at Sea, a family-focused educational cruise experience led by Mouse Wife Adventures aboard Royal Caribbean.
The first sailing is planned for February 25 to March 2, 2027 on Harmony of the Seas from Port Canaveral. This sailing will explore science, engineering, history, art and music through immersive family-based activities, with special features including a guest from NASA, Kindermusik, Root & Wonder and a Queen’s Staircase experience in Nassau with the Bahamian Historical Society.
The heart of the program is playful learning. Activities may include buoyancy experiments, build-a-boat challenges, music and movement, art projects, beach exploration, sandcastle physics, bedtime stories, family dinners and optional cultural or historical field trips. Families will also be invited to bring an old book from home to help create a small group library exchange during the sailing.
The mascot, Shami, represents Science, History, Art, Music and Interactive learning. Shami, along with Higgs, helps bring the program to life in a fun, kid-friendly way that makes learning feel like an adventure instead of a classroom assignment.
A sample agenda includes a welcome dinner on Day 1, a CocoCay beach day with optional sandcastle and nature activities on Day 2, a sea day with science programming on Day 3, Nassau exploration with an optional historical field trip on Day 4, a final sea day with farewell activities on Day 5 and optional breakfast together before disembarkation on Day 6.

STEM at Sea works like a regular family cruise, but with special optional breakout activities created just for our group.
You still get the full Royal Caribbean cruise experience, including dining, entertainment, ports, pools, shows and kids clubs. The difference is that our group will also have exclusive programming woven into the sailing. On sea days, we will offer optional family-focused sessions that may include science, engineering, art, music, hands-on learning activities and themed experiences designed for kids and their grown-ups to enjoy together.
At the ports, we will also have optional group meetups or activities that connect to the destination, whether that is beach exploration, cultural learning, history or just spending time together as a group.
This is not a drop-off program and we will not be providing childcare. The sessions are designed for caretakers and children to participate together. Royal Caribbean does offer kids clubs on board for families who want adult time during the cruise, but STEM at Sea itself is all about shared learning, connection and making memories together.
We will also have group dining with like-minded families who believe vacations can be fun, meaningful and educational. It is a chance to meet other caregivers and littles who value hands-on learning, curiosity and togetherness.
In the evenings, we plan to include wind-down moments like bedtime stories, plus a group book exchange library where families can bring an old book from home and swap with others during the sailing.
